Primary Risks of Keeping Junk at Home

Retaining unused items for long periods creates more than just an eyesore; it introduces genuine dangers to the household. Large piles of old clothes, cardboard, or furniture serve as fuel for house fires. According to data from the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ission, cluttered pathways and rooms significantly hinder exit routes during emergencies and increase the likelihood of tripping accidents.

Physical clutter also creates an inviting habitat for pests. In the humid climate of North Carolina, stacks of paper or old wood quickly become breeding grounds for cockroaches, termites, and rodents. Research from North Carolina State University indicates that reducing indoor clutter is a fundamental step in integrated pest management because it removes the hiding spots and nesting materials these pests require.

Structural integrity is another concern. Many homeowners store heavy items in attics or crawlspaces that were not designed for such weight. Over time, this can lead to sagging floors or cracked supports. Moisture often gets trapped behind large piles of junk, leading to mold growth that can spread to the drywall and framing of the house.

Financial Benefits of Decluttering and Removal

Maintaining a clean home has a direct impact on market value. When a property appears cramped or dirty due to excess belongings, potential buyers often perceive the home as poorly maintained. A survey by Real Estate Witch found that home sellers who declutter their spaces can see a significant increase in their home’s resale value, sometimes by thousands of dollars.

Efficiency in home maintenance also saves money over time. When a home is clear, it is easier to spot leaks, cracks, or electrical issues before they become expensive repairs. Raleigh Residential Waste Management Comparison

The table below outlines common categories of household waste and the specific considerations for Raleigh residents.

Waste Category Potential Hazards Recommended Action
Old Electronics Heavy metals and toxic chemicals Certified e-waste recycling
Bulky Furniture Fire fuel and pest nesting Professional hauling or donation
Construction Debris Sharp objects and structural weight Industrial-grade removal
Yard Waste Drainage issues and snake habitats Seasonal green waste hauling
Appliance Scrap Refrigerant leaks and entrapment Appliance-specific disposal

When to Hire Junk Removal Rather Than DIY

Homeowners often struggle to decide between handling the heavy lifting themselves or hiring professional junk removal services Raleigh NC provides. While DIY seems cheaper initially, the hidden costs often add up. Renting a truck, paying for gas, and covering disposal fees at the Wake County landfill can be expensive. Furthermore, the risk of personal injury while moving heavy appliances or furniture is high for those without proper training and equipment.

Professional services bring the necessary tools, such as dollies, ramps, and heavy-duty trucks, to complete the job in a fraction of the time. This efficiency is particularly important during major life events like moving, estate settling, or preparing for a renovation. Psychological and Health Advantages

The importance of decluttering extends beyond the physical structure of the house. Mental health is closely tied to the environment. Living in a cluttered space can lead to chronic stress and a lack of focus. A study published by the Association for Psychological Science suggests that people in cluttered environments are more likely to experience higher levels of cortisol, the body’s primary stress hormone.

Air quality also improves when junk is removed. Old upholstery, dusty boxes, and stacks of paper trap allergens like dust mites and pet dander. By clearing out these items, homeowners can reduce respiratory triggers and create a cleaner breathing environment. This is especially beneficial in Raleigh, where seasonal pollen already challenges indoor air quality.

Decisions Before Starting a Cleanout

Once the decision is made to reclaim your space for health and safety, proper preparation is key. Before contacting a service provider, homeowners should evaluate several factors to ensure a smooth process.

First, identify the volume of items. Most services charge based on the space used in the truck. Grouping items together in a central location like a driveway or garage can sometimes lower the labor time.

Second, check for hazardous materials. Most standard junk removal companies cannot take wet paint, oil, gasoline, or certain chemicals due to environmental regulations. These items usually require a trip to a specialized Wake County household hazardous waste facility.

Third, consider the timing. In Raleigh, the spring and early summer are peak times for cleanouts. Scheduling a few weeks in advance ensures you get the preferred date and time.

Common Questions About Removing Household Items

How do Raleigh disposal fees work?

Disposal fees in the Raleigh area are typically based on weight or volume at local transfer stations. Professional services include these fees in their overall quotes, so homeowners do not have to worry about paying the landfill directly.

Are there items that professional haulers won’t take?

Yes, most companies avoid hazardous waste such as asbestos, lead-based paint, and explosive materials. It is always best to provide a list of items when requesting an estimate to avoid confusion on the day of the job.

Does junk removal include cleaning?

Generally, junk removal focuses on the hauling and disposal of items. While most crews will sweep up the immediate area after removing the junk, they do not provide deep cleaning or janitorial services.

How does junk removal benefit the local environment?

Reliable companies prioritize recycling and responsible disposal. By diverting items from landfills and ensuring that electronics are processed at certified facilities, professional hauling reduces the environmental footprint of a household.

How long does a typical home cleanout take?

Most residential jobs are completed within two to four hours. Large-scale estate cleanouts or hoarding situations can take a full day or more depending on the volume of material and the ease of access to the property.

Can junk removal help with home renovations?

Absolutely. Removing old flooring, cabinets, and drywall debris as it is created keeps the job site safe and organized. This allows contractors to work more efficiently and prevents the accumulation of dangerous construction waste.

What happens to the items after they are picked up?

Items are typically sorted. Recyclable materials go to processing centers, usable goods go to local non-profits, and the remaining debris is taken to a licensed landfill. This ensures that the least amount of waste possible ends up in the ground.
